Abstract
PURPOSE: To enable to cool efficiently by a method wherein an air is contacted to carbon fibers containing a moiture adsorbent and/or a moisure absorbent to obtain dry air, and te carbon fibers having absorbed the moisture are regenerated by heating.
CONSTITUTION: In a cooling system for cooling by cold water which is obtained by contacting dry air to water, the dry air is obtained by contacting air to the carbon fibers 1 formed into the shape of a nonwoven fabric sheet and containing the moisture adsorbent (absorbent), and the carbon fibers 1 is dried and regenerated by heating them with the solar heat or the like. In the case of using the sheets of carbon fibers 1 after assembling them into a honeycomb structure, air A to be treated enters the structure at one side face, while a cooling gas B enters the structure at a face perpendicular to said side face, and both gases pass through the gaps in the structure respectively. In this case, the air A is deprived of moisture by adsorption and is taken out as dry air, the degree of dryness being enhanced due to the cooling by the cooling gas B which flows in the direction orthogonal to that of the ariflow.
